We no longer esteem ourselves sufficiently when we communicate ourselves. Our true experiences are not at all garrulous. They could not communicate themselves even if they tried. That is because they lack the right word. Whatever we have words for, that we have already got beyond... Language, it seems, was invented only for what is average, medium, communicable. With language the speaker immediately vulgarizes himself.
Friedrich Nietzsche, Twilight of the Idols
Insurrectionary acts and movements require breaking silence - silence about the very existence as well as the activity or injury of the collective insurrectionary subject.
[..]
But if the silences in discourses of domination are a site for insurrectionary noise, if they are the corridors we must fill with explosive counter-tales, it is also possible to make a fetish of breaking silence. Even more than a fetish, it is possible that this ostensible tool of emancipation carries its own techniques of subjugation - that it converges with non-emancipatory tendencies in contemporary culture (for example, the ubiquity of confessional discourse and rampant personalization of political life), that it establishes regulatory norms, coincides with the disciplinary power of confession, in short, feeds the powers we meant to starve.
Wendy Brown, "In the 'folds of our own discourse': The Pleasures and Freedoms of Silence" (1996) 3 U Chi L Sch Roundtable 185
